The call crypto_del_alg does not free anything immediately. It can only start freeing things once the final tfm user goes away. Any crypto request of that tfm must have completed before that happens. If not there is a serious bug in the Crypto API. So if crypto_del_alg is leading to a freeing of the pd while there are still outstanding users of that tfm, then this points to a bug in the Crypto API and not padata. Can you still reproduce this bug easily if you revert the patches in this series? If so we should be able to track down the real bug. To recap, every tfm holds a ref count on the underlying crypto_alg. All crypto requests must complete before a tfm can be freed, which then leads to a drop of the refcount on crypto_alg. A crypto_alg can only be freed when its ref count hits zero. Only then will the associated pd be freed. So what's missing in the above picture is the entity that is freeing the tfm, thus leading to the actual freeing of the alg and pd.
